How to Prepare for a Road Trip

We know that traveling might not be in your plans for the next month or so. But as we are slowly able to travel and get outdoors again after the COVID-19 pandemic, you may be considering planning a road trip at the end of summer.

If you’re planning on taking the family on a road trip in the next coming months, making sure that you are organized and prepared will keep your family happy and minimize the stress of the trip.

Here are some tips on how to get you and your family ready for your road trip:

  • Make sure to plan breaks along the way. A short break every couple of hours is recommended. These could be at rest stops or gas stations, just a chance to get out of the car and stretch your legs. If kids are traveling along, you may find that bathroom breaks will be needed during these breaks, too. 
     
  • Schedule out activities during the car ride. For instance, have a nap time, a reading time, a movie time (if possible), and maybe a snack time. This will help keep the kids occupied and also keep them from getting overwhelmed during the car ride.
     
  • Have plenty of snacks and drinks on hand. Kids are especially going to get hungry along the way, and it won’t hurt the driving adults to have a snack as well to keep their energy up. This will also help to save money along the way as well. 
     
  • Pack comfortably! Be sure to bring pillows and blankets for the kids and other passengers.
